Julia Barretto’s sexy photoshoot for “Expensive Candy” may be her most daring yet

When Julia Barretto dons a tiny black dress, the internet is guaranteed to go into a frenzy, and this never fails to happen. When she wore it out for the first time, everyone went crazy about it and wanted to know where they could get it! It goes without saying that she always manages to look effortlessly elegant whenever she is seen wearing a little black dress while on vacation. The most recent time she left us with our mouths agape was when she appeared in a photoshoot for her newest movie, Expensive Candy, wearing a black hubadera dress.

Related Posts

Candy is the name of the prostitute that Julia will portray in her future film (the trailer already promises us quite the steamy watch). Photographer Andrea Beldua took pictures of the 25-year-old model posing in a slinky Jemore Wilson LBD with cut-outs that flaunt her hip in order to provide fans with a sneak peek of the character. Deb Bernales added an extra dose of glitz to the ensemble by accessorizing it with chunky gold jewelry and timeless black stilettos.

Bea Buangan, Julia’s hair stylist, gave her light brown locks a tousled look and then waved them gently in a way that truly brought out the seductive undertones. Her makeup artist, Barbie, proceeded to apply a sparkly orange tint to her eyes, and she finished off her glam look by applying a glossy peach lip gloss.

That’s not the end of it! The actress also posed with her co-star Carlo Aquino when she was wearing a maillot with a leopard print and underwear. Carlo was her leading man in the film. This intrepid and risk-taking aspect of Julia is one of our favorite things about her.

With receiving a sneak peek of Candy in this spread, we can’t speak for you, but after what we’ve seen of her, we’re definitely more than excited to finally meet her.
